SME et OPenSI

Forum dédié à la distribution du même nom et que vous pourrez télécharger sur http://www.contribs.org. La nouvelle version de cette distribution se nomme SME Server

Modérateur: modos Ixus

SME et OPenSI

Messagepar dadoudidon » 19 Juin 2007 11:15

Bonjour à tous,

Je cherche à faire fonctionner OpenSI http://www.opensi.org/portail/index.php avec SME7.
Merci pour le tuto java+tomcat de MasterSleepy.
Par contre impossible de faire fonctionner OpenSI.
OpenSI est une solution de comptabilité, gestion clients, fournisseurs facturation..... très perfectionnée et très intuitive.

Si par hasard un ou une d'entre vous réussi à faire fonctionner OpenSI sur sme, je suis preneur.

merci à tous

David
dadoudidon
Premier-Maître
Premier-Maître
 
Messages: 65
Inscrit le: 19 Juin 2007 10:39
Localisation: Beaucroissant

Messagepar Cool34000 » 21 Juin 2007 04:24

Salut

:idea: Je lâche jamais l’affaire !!! J’aurai mérité mon dodo…

Allez, vite avant d’aller se coucher :
Installer complètement par défaut comme préconisée par MasterSleepy pour Tomcat (avec les liens à jour)
Editer le fichier /opt/tomcat/conf/tomcat-users.xml
Voici un exemple de fichier modifié :
<?xml version='1.0' encoding='utf-8'?>
<tomcat-users>
<role rolename="tomcat"/>
<role rolename="role1"/>
<role rolename="manager"/>
<role rolename="admin"/>

<user username="tomcat" password="tomcat" roles="tomcat"/>
<user username="role1" password="tomcat" roles="role1"/>
<user username="both" password="tomcat" roles="tomcat,role1"/>
<user username="admin" password="admin" roles="admin,manager,tomcat,role1"/>
</tomcat-users>

Décompresser l’archive opensi-serveur-3.8.gz dans /opt/tomcat/webapps/
Et s'assurer que tomcat soit proprio des lieux
Code: Tout sélectionner
# chown -R tomcat:tomcat /opt/tomcat/webapps/OpenSI/


Editer la base de données avant de l'importer (./OpenSI/database/mysql/General.sql)
-- SCHEMA BASE DE DONNÉES OPENSI << GENERAL >>

GRANT ALL PRIVILEGES on opensi.* to 'opensi'@'localhost' identified by 'opensi';
au lieu de
GRANT ALL PRIVILEGES on *.* to 'opensi'@'localhost' identified by 'opensi';

Adapter et renommer le fichier opensi.linux.cfg (mot de passe et chemin vers OpenSI) comme décrit dans la doc d'install

Modifier MySQL :
Code: Tout sélectionner
# config setprop mysqld LocalNetworkingOnly no
# expand-template /etc/my.cnf && service mysqld restart
# service tomcat stop && service tomcat start

Et voila :P
Avec le module Firefox, se connecter en superadmin avec le mot de passe "root" :roll:
Avatar de l’utilisateur
Cool34000
Contre-Amiral
Contre-Amiral
 
Messages: 480
Inscrit le: 10 Sep 2006 10:45
Localisation: Nimes, France

Messagepar MasterSleepy » 21 Juin 2007 08:18

Salut Cool,

Joli pour l'installation.
J'ai également essayé d'installer ce soft mais j'en était au même point que dadoudidon.

Les étapes que je n'ai pas faite sont
- Créé l'utilisateur admin dans le tomcat-users.xml
et
Code: Tout sélectionner
config setprop mysqld LocalNetworkingOnly no


A mon avis le problème devrait, selon moi, venir de la création de l'utilisateur dans le tomcat-users.
La modification de mysql je ne comprends pas pourquoi elle a du être faite?

A+,
MasterSleepy.
"Microsoft fera quelque chose qui ne plantera jamais quand ils commenceront à fabriquer des clous "
http://www.vanhees.cc
Avatar de l’utilisateur
MasterSleepy
Amiral
Amiral
 
Messages: 2625
Inscrit le: 24 Juil 2002 00:00
Localisation: Belgique

Messagepar Cool34000 » 21 Juin 2007 09:26

Salut,


Ne me demandez pas de ressortir mes sources, c'était à 4h00 du mat, je désespérai !
Tout vient des forums OpenSI et également des forums d'Ubuntu. J'ai trouvé quelques cas similaires qui m'ont guidés vers la solution finale... J'ai tellement fait de tests et de changements que j'ai du refaire une install propre pour savoir ce qui avait vraiment besoin d'etre changé ! :lol:

Heureux que ca marche en tout ca parce que ca m'a empéché de dormir tant que ca n'a pas marché ! :twisted:


Bonne journée !
Avatar de l’utilisateur
Cool34000
Contre-Amiral
Contre-Amiral
 
Messages: 480
Inscrit le: 10 Sep 2006 10:45
Localisation: Nimes, France

Messagepar dadoudidon » 21 Juin 2007 09:31

oula!

j'essaye de suite

et ça marche
bravo Sylvain
et merci

David
dadoudidon
Premier-Maître
Premier-Maître
 
Messages: 65
Inscrit le: 19 Juin 2007 10:39
Localisation: Beaucroissant

Messagepar dadoudidon » 21 Juin 2007 13:00

MasterSleepy a écrit:A mon avis le problème devrait, selon moi, venir de la création de l'utilisateur dans le tomcat-users.
La modification de mysql je ne comprends pas pourquoi elle a du être faite?


Non, on avait essayé avec la modif dans le tomcat-users et on avait toujours "login incorrect"
David
dadoudidon
Premier-Maître
Premier-Maître
 
Messages: 65
Inscrit le: 19 Juin 2007 10:39
Localisation: Beaucroissant

Messagepar dadoudidon » 21 Juin 2007 13:03

Cool34000 a écrit:Adapter et renommer le fichier opensi.linux.cfg (mot de passe et chemin vers OpenSI) comme décrit dans la doc d'install


surtout penser à renommer le fichier opensi.linux.cfg en opensi.cfg

David
dadoudidon
Premier-Maître
Premier-Maître
 
Messages: 65
Inscrit le: 19 Juin 2007 10:39
Localisation: Beaucroissant

Messagepar dlalleme » 21 Juin 2007 23:18

Bonsoir,

Dommage que j'ai lu le message trop tard, sinon j'aurai répondu plus tôt.
:cry:
J'ai installé opensi il y a déjà quelques mois et je n'ai jamais eu le temps d'en parler....

Je relis les précédents messages, puis je fais mes remarques (si j'en ai) un peu plus tard :wink:

Cordialement

Denis
Avatar de l’utilisateur
dlalleme
Vice-Amiral
Vice-Amiral
 
Messages: 521
Inscrit le: 02 Déc 2002 01:00
Localisation: Oise, bassin creillois

Messagepar Cool34000 » 28 Juin 2007 09:01

Salut,

Quelqu'un a t'il tenté la connexion entre tomcat et apache ? (mod_jk)
Merci pour vos réponses...


Sylvain
Avatar de l’utilisateur
Cool34000
Contre-Amiral
Contre-Amiral
 
Messages: 480
Inscrit le: 10 Sep 2006 10:45
Localisation: Nimes, France

Messagepar Mikeyy72 » 16 Août 2007 20:43

Bonsoir,

Moi je viens d'installer Java et smeserver-tomcat-5.5.23... sur SME 7.2
J'accède bien sur Tomcat via une page web sur le port 8181.
Via Firefox, j'arrive au login OpenSI mais impossible d'aller plus loin.

Manager( Superviseur) - password : root
"Connexion au serveur impossible. Vérifiez vos paramètres.)

Je ne vois pas où est l'erreur!!

Si vous avez des infos, je suis preneur !!!


Merci
Mikeyy72
Enseigne de vaisseau
Enseigne de vaisseau
 
Messages: 156
Inscrit le: 09 Oct 2006 11:42

Messagepar dadoudidon » 20 Août 2007 09:36

Mikeyy72 a écrit:Bonsoir,

Moi je viens d'installer Java et smeserver-tomcat-5.5.23... sur SME 7.2
J'accède bien sur Tomcat via une page web sur le port 8181.
Via Firefox, j'arrive au login OpenSI mais impossible d'aller plus loin.

Manager( Superviseur) - password : root
"Connexion au serveur impossible. Vérifiez vos paramètres.)

Je ne vois pas où est l'erreur!!

Si vous avez des infos, je suis preneur !!!


Merci


As-tu bien entré les paramètres de connection dans le client OpenSI?

adresse du serveur:l'ip de ton serveur
port:8181
Servlet: OpenSI

David
dadoudidon
Premier-Maître
Premier-Maître
 
Messages: 65
Inscrit le: 19 Juin 2007 10:39
Localisation: Beaucroissant

Messagepar Mikeyy72 » 20 Août 2007 10:21

Bonjour,

Oui, tout était bien renseigné et j'ai même essayé plusieurs configurations différentes.

J'ai fini par contourné mon 'problème', en me disant que de toute façon, je n'allais pas garder une application de comta-gestion sur mon serveur SME.

Alors je lui ai dédié un poste où j'ai installé Ubuntu 7.04 et OpenSI.
Tout fonctionne bien et OpenSI est accessible via le réseau, ça me convient mieux !!

Merci
Mikeyy72
Enseigne de vaisseau
Enseigne de vaisseau
 
Messages: 156
Inscrit le: 09 Oct 2006 11:42

Messagepar STRyk » 08 Sep 2007 02:25

Mikeyy72 a écrit:Manager( Superviseur) - password : root
"Connexion au serveur impossible. Vérifiez vos paramètres.)

Je ne vois pas où est l'erreur!!

Si vous avez des infos, je suis preneur !!!


Merci

Pour moi idem...
4 heures a essayer mais toujours au même point :(
J'ai trouvé des liens qui reviennent souvent à ce post.
Avec OpenSI 3.8 et le fichier "opensi-3.8.xpi" dans FireFox:
"Connexion au serveur impossible. Vérifiez vos paramètres."

Mais à quoi sers Tomcat ? il gère les users/pass ? etc... rien de clair :(

Merci.
STRyk
Second Maître
Second Maître
 
Messages: 32
Inscrit le: 15 Nov 2006 03:03

Messagepar Cool34000 » 08 Sep 2007 03:41

Avatar de l’utilisateur
Cool34000
Contre-Amiral
Contre-Amiral
 
Messages: 480
Inscrit le: 10 Sep 2006 10:45
Localisation: Nimes, France

Messagepar STRyk » 08 Sep 2007 04:32


Merci pour le second RPM, je ne leconaissais pas.

Pour le dernier lien oui j'avais vu aussi :)
Merci tout de même.

Une chose que je n'avais pasdécoché "Server sécurisé" !! Arf...
J'ai donc pu me logger en décochant cette option.
Je ne comprends pas trop pourquoi mais bon... :roll:
STRyk
Second Maître
Second Maître
 
Messages: 32
Inscrit le: 15 Nov 2006 03:03

Suivant

Retour vers E-Smith / SME Server

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Google [Bot] et 1 invité